* [PowerPC] Remove allow-deprecated-dag-overlap and fix broken testsJinsong Ji2019-11-121-3/+3
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: This is found during review of https://reviews.llvm.org/D67088. CHECK-DAG is non-overlapping after https://reviews.llvm.org/D47106. -allow-deprecated-dag-overlap was introduced to temporary accept old behavior. But it actually hide some broken tests, eg: `test/CodeGen/PowerPC/swaps-le-1.ll` The codegen has changed, but the CHECK-DAG still PASS due to allowing `overlap`. This patch remove the deprecated options, and fix the broken tests. * VirtRegMap: Replace some identity copies with KILL instructions.Matthias Braun2016-07-091-0/+4
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| An identity COPY like this: %AL = COPY %AL, %EAX<imp-def> has no semantic effect, but encodes liveness information: Further users of %EAX only depend on this instruction even though it does not define the full register. Replace the COPY with a KILL instruction in those cases to maintain this liveness information. (This reverts a small part of r238588 but this time adds a comment explaining why a KILL instruction is useful). llvm-svn: 274952
* [PowerPC] Use the MachineCombiner to reassociate fadd/fmulHal Finkel2015-07-151-0/+188
This is a direct port of the code from the X86 backend (r239486/r240361), which uses the MachineCombiner to reassociate (floating-point) adds/muls to increase ILP, to the PowerPC backend. The rationale is the same. There is a lot of copy-and-paste here between the X86 code and the PowerPC code, and we should extract at least some of this into CodeGen somewhere. However, I don't want to do that until this code is enhanced to handle FMAs as well. After that, we'll be in a better position to extract the common parts. llvm-svn: 242279
